The Significance of Mewtwo in Pokémon Go
Mewtwo, one of the original legendary Pokémon introduced in Pokémon Go, has continued to capture the hearts of trainers worldwide. As a Psychic-type Pokémon, Mewtwo boasts exceptional stats, making it a formidable opponent in battles and an essential addition to any trainer’s roster. The importance of Mewtwo in the game is underscored by its frequent appearances in high-level raids, making it a frequent target for trainers seeking to enhance their combat capabilities.

Combat Power and Strategies
Mewtwo possesses high combat power (CP), reaching up to 4,200 CP at level 40, making it one of the strongest Pokémon in the game. Its signature move, Psystrike, is a Psychic-type Charged Attack, which deals massive damage in battles. Trainers looking to capture Mewtwo should prepare meticulously: using Dark-type Pokémon, like Tyranitar or Gyarados, can help counter Mewtwo’s Psychic attacks effectively. Furthermore, employing a precise strategy of dodging and timing moves can significantly increase a trainer’s chances of defeating and subsequently capturing this elusive Pokémon.
